What is Dental Bonding?
Dental bonding is a beautifying dental process that beautifies the appearance of teeth by applying a tooth-colored resin material. This treatment is commonly used for fixing broken, stained or somewhat crooked teeth. It is a gentle and economical choice to veneers and crowns, making it a preferred choice for many patients looking for smile enhancement.
Why is Dental Bonding Growing Popular?
1. Cost-effective and Attainable Cosmetic Dentistry
In comparison with other cosmetic dental solutions such as porcelain veneers or dental crowns, tooth bonding is considerably more cost-effective. Many patients choose it due to its reasonable pricing and rapid treatment.
2. Minimally Interfering Procedure
Contrary to veneers or crowns that demand enamel reduction, composite bonding maintains the natural tooth structure. The procedure does not require drilling or anesthesia in most cases, making it a comfortable and uncomplicated treatment.
3. Quick Results with Single-Visit Treatment
One of the primary reasons for the rising trend in composite bonding is the immediate change it offers. Patients can obtain a spotless smile in just a single dental visit, removing the need for numerous appointments.
4. Attractive and Realistic Result
Advanced composite resins replicate the natural shade and clarity of teeth, making a seamless and realistic smile. This has made composite bonding into a popular option for individuals wanting an aesthetic improvement without an fake appearance.

FAQ (FAQ)
1. How long does composite bonding last?
Composite bonding typically endures between 5-7 years, depending on oral hygiene and lifestyle habits. Routine dental check-ups and appropriate care can increase its lifespan.
2. Does composite bonding stain over time?
Yes, composite resin can become tarnished from coffee, tea, and smoking. However, periodic dental cleanings and appropriate oral hygiene help maintain its color.
3. Is composite bonding painful?
No, composite bonding is a comfortable procedure as it does not demand anesthesia or drilling in most cases.
4. Can composite bonding correct gaps between teeth?
Yes, composite bonding is an effective solution for fixing small gaps between teeth, upgrading overall smile aesthetics.
